Location.
The Hyatt Regency Boston is located across the street from the Opera House in Boston's theater district, next to Downtown Crossing and just 1 block from Macy's department store and the Park Street Station. Boston Common, the Freedom Trail, and the financial district are located 2 blocks away.
Hotel Features.
This property is built around 4 terraced atria, while the third-floor lobby features marble floors accented with area rugs and greenery. Avenue One restaurant serves contemporary American cuisine within an informal setting. The Lobby Lounge prepares martinis and serves wines, beers and spirits. Live bands perform in the lounge seasonally, and guests can find complimentary newspapers in the lobby. The 24-hour business center houses 5 computer stations and is staffed during business hours. A total of 30,000 square feet of function space includes a grand ballroom, open-air terraces and 21 individual rooms. Wireless Internet access is available throughout the hotel (surcharge).
Recreational amenities include a complimentary, 24-hour fitness facility that houses a dry sauna, a eucalyptus steam room, television-mounted cardiovascular equipment, weight-training machines and yoga balls. Personal training is available for a surcharge. Massages, manicures, and pedicures are available with advanced registration (surcharge). A sundeck adjoins an indoor lap pool.
Guestrooms.
This 22-story property offers 500 nonsmoking guestrooms equipped with wireless Internet access (surcharge), and flat-screen televisions. Hyatt Grand Beds feature 250-thread count linens, an array of European roll and throw pillows, and down duvets. Cherry-wood furniture complements earth-tone color schemes. Marble-clad bathrooms contain makeup mirrors, bathrobes and shower/tub combinations. Rooms contain coffeemakers and minibars.
